How to store soft cream cheese
Soft cream cheese should be stored in the refrigerator in its original container. It should be consumed within seven days of opening to maintain freshness. To prevent contamination, it is important to always use a clean utensil when removing cream cheese from the container. Soft cream cheese should never be left at room temperature for an extended period of time, as this can cause spoilage and bacterial growth.
Can soft cream cheese be frozen?
Soft cream cheese can be frozen, but it may not retain its texture and flavor when thawed. To freeze cream cheese, remove it from its original container and wrap it t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il. Place it in a freezer-safe container or bag and store it in the freezer for up to two months. When ready to use, thaw the cream cheese in the refrigerator for several hours. It may be best to use thawed cream cheese in dishes that call for a melted or blended texture, rather than a spreadable consistency.

2. How is Soft Cream Cheese made?
Soft Cream Cheese is made by adding a bacterial culture to milk and cream, which causes the mixture to ferment and thicken. The curds are then separated from the whey, and the resulting cheese is mixed with salt and other flavorings to create the final product.
